WebOct 28, 2024 · Can an LLC own a corporation? Yes, if it is a C Corporation. If a corporation has chosen to file with the IRS to be taxed as an S Corporation, an LLC (Limited Liability Company) may not have ownership over it as S Corporations may only be owned by natural persons. Secs. 301. 7701 - 2 and - 3, an entity that is formed as a corporation under local law is automatically classified as a corporation. When an entity is not a corporation under local law, its classification for federal tax purposes depends on whether it has more than one member (owner).
